Work study is a state and federally funded program that supports part-time jobs for students who need help to meet the costs of attending college. The program provides income and job experience to students and funding to the employers who hire them. Having work study makes you a more attractive candidate to University employers.

The first eligibility requirement for a Meals on Wheels application is related to age an...For example, if a school wanted to spend $45,000 of its FWS federal funds for student wages, it would be required to provide at least $15,000 in nonfederal funds. A total of $60,000 would then be available to pay student wages under the school’s FWS Program. Your Federal Work-Study is part of your financial aid award package. Work-Study wages are earned at an hourly rate of $12 and paid every other week. You and your supervisor will be notified to complete and approve timecards to track your time. Failure to complete timecards by the deadlines will result in delayed paychecks ... STUDENT EMPLOYMENT STUDENT HANDBOOKWages earned under the Federal Work-Study Program are considered earned income and are subject to Federal, state, and local tax withholding. Students employed under the Federal Work-Study Program will receive a W-2 form at the end of January that documents all earnings at the University for that tax year. Federal Work-Study (FWS) is a need-based program that provides part-time employment opportunities for students to aid with the costs of post-secondary education. The federal funds cover 75-90% of the wages through this program, whereas the institutions subsidize the rest. The Federal Work-Study Program (FWS), formerly known as the College Work-Study Program, was first established as part of the Higher Education Act of 1965. It provides funding to pay full-time college students who meet financial eligibility requirements for part-time employment.

Indicate your preference for ...The amount of “work-study” aid you’re eligible for will be listed in your financial aid award letter. There’s no minimum or maximum amount of “work-study” that you’ll see in your financial aid letter. The exact amount will depend on your school’s work-study program. Usually, the eligible amount is anywhere from $2,000 to $5,000 ...
